Some of the most common reasons people need garage door repair in Berlin, Connecticut are listed below:
Garage Door Won't Open or Shut
A garage door that won't open or close might be caused by many different problems including broken springs and cables, broken or misaligned sensors, or a damaged garage door opener. Our Berlin garage door pros can do an inspection to figure out the cause and get it repaired for you.
Damaged Garage Door Springs
Damaged springs are a common complaint which arises after a lot of use. We can assist with torsion or extension spring service, replacing broken springs, or performing spring adjustment for single family or commercial properties. We can also help with both torque master and torsion springs.
Broken or Frayed Garage Door Cables
Cables can break over time. We'll get a service technician out to install new cables or fix damaged cables.
Broken Garage Door Hinges
Hardware and hinges can wear out with frequent use. Broken hinges can damage the garage door and make it hard to open. If you spot broken hinges, get them fixed as soon as you can to prevent more damage.
Broken Garage Door Panels
If your garage door panels are damaged, or the hardware needs repairing, our service pros can get this fixed for you. Our Berlin team members work with wooden garage doors, steel garage doors, and vinyl garage doors.
Garage door clickers
Garage door remotes can break down over time. Sometimes a simple battery replacement can solve it, but other times you could need a new remote to be programmed. Our Berlin garage door service technicians can repair and program garage remotes, set up vehicle remotes, and also put in outside garage door keypads.
Improperly aligned garage door
Keeping your garage door correctly aligned is very important, and will extend the life of both your garage door and garage door opener. If something is out of whack, give us a call to get it repaired.
Garage Door Banging Noise
Banging noises are often caused by unbalanced doors. It's best to get this problem addressed sooner rather than later to prevent other damage from occurring.
Weather Stripping Repair
As your garage door gets older, the weather stripping or trim may deteriorate and need replacement. Repairing the weather stripping will help insulate your garage and keep undesirable critters out.
Rattling Garage Door Noises
Rattling sounds may be the result of loose nuts or bolts, dry parts needing to be lubricated , unbalanced doors, or a garage door opener that was not correctly put in.
Garage Door Scraping Noises
Scraping sounds are often the result of unbalanced doors.
Squeaking Garage Door
Squeaking noises may be due to a loose roller or hinge, parts needing greasing, or unbalanced doors.
Rubbing Sound Garage Door
Rubbing could be due to bent tracks or a jammed or tight track which needs adjusting.
Grinding Sound Garage Door
Grinding noises could be caused by parts needing lubrication, loose rollers or hinges, a stripped garage door opener gear, or an incorrectly hung opener.
Slapping Garage Door Sound
Slapping noises are sometimes caused by a loose chain.
Vibrating Garage Door Sound
Vibrating sounds are frequently caused by loose parts or rollers needing oiling.
Popping Noise Garage Door
Popping noises may be the result of torsion spring issues.

Garage Door Opener Installation
The median lifespan of a garage door opener is about 10-15 years. Regular upkeep, lubrication, and taking care to be sure your garage door is balanced will increase the lifespan of your opener. For safety reasons, if you own a garage door opener that was produced before 1993, it’s always recommended to have it replaced instead of fixed.
